Corrinnah is a modern elaboration of Corinna/Corina, which derives from ancient Greek Korinna, a diminutive of korē meaning “maiden.” Latinized as Corinna, the name appears in classical literature; Ovid famously addressed a lover called Corinna in the Amores, giving it enduring literary prestige.
Carried through Latin and French, it entered English use by the 17th century - immortalized in Robert Herrick’s poem “Corinna’s Going A-Maying” - and saw Romantic-era revivals. In the United States, spellings such as Corrina and Corrine gained visibility in the 20th century, aided by the blues standard “Corrina, Corrina.” The form Corrinnah adds a final -h, echoing Hannah and highlighting the soft ending; it remains rare but easily parsed as kuh-RIN-uh. Related variants include Corinna, Corina, Corrina, French Corinne, German Korinna/Korina, and Italian/Spanish Corina/Corinna, with diminutives Cora, Cori, and Rina. The name conveys “maiden” and a lyrical, springlike aura.
